China is doing this sort of thing, and worse, they're just less obvious about it.

For instance, China operates unauthorized police stations inside other countries, which they use to enforce party loyalty and target dissidents.

You should also read the article about Chinese government interference in Canada:

The Canadian government has been tracking Chinese government efforts to influence Canada since at least 1986.

In 2016, newspaper sources reported that Justin Trudeau had been attending cash-for-access events at the homes of wealthy Chinese Canadians in Toronto and Vancouver, generating a political scandal. Attendees at these events, including those with connections to the CCP, would pay up to $1,525 per ticket to meet Trudeau.

The People's Republic of China made attempts to interfere in the 2019 Canadian federal election and 2021 Canadian federal election and threatened Canadian politicians, according to Canadian Security Intelligence Service (CSIS) and the Parliament of Canada's Foreign Interference Commission.

PRC manipulation activities in Canada are well documented, but it would be extremely naive to think they aren't pulling the same shit in other countries.
